This Premier League clash between Everton and Tottenham Hotspur on the 3rd of February ended in a 2-2 draw, providing an even balance of power and strategy at play. When analyzing the statistics, a few key elements stand out that significantly influenced the outcome.

Firstly looking at the goals, Tottenham Hotspur secured an early lead, scoring at the 3-minute mark of the first half. Everton evened the score at almost half an hour into the game and fell behind again when Tottenham scored just ten minutes later. The second half saw Everton equalize once more at the 33:50 mark.

Now, moving our attention to discipline on the pitch, Everton played a more aggressive game with three yellow cards all received in the second half compared to Tottenham's clean slate on the disciplinary front. This aggressive play style from Everton may have contributed to their equalizing goal late in the second half. However, it also put them at a disadvantage, considering the possible anxiety about a potential red card.

Turning towards the game flow statistics, Everton dominated the corner kicks with 9 compared to Tottenham's 5. This suggests pressure on Tottenham's defense, translating into scoring opportunities for Everton. Nevertheless, it also indicates that Tottenham successfully defended these set-piece situations, holding Everton to a draw.

On the other hand, offsides tell us a different story; Everton was caught offside five times compared to Tottenham's solitary incident. This indicates that Tottenham's high line of defense managed to trap Everton's forward players, disrupting their attacking plans.

Lastly, foul play was heavier on Tottenham's side with 13 compared to Everton's 8. This suggests that Everton's attacking play might have put Tottenham under pressure, leading to their increased fouls count.

In conclusion, both teams showcased notable performances featuring their distinct strategic applications. It was a game balanced on the edge, with both sides showing admirable fight and resilience. The evident toughness on the pitch, coupled with high-level strategic play, culminated in a high-intensity draw that highlighted both teams' combined strengths and unique gameplay.
